Available for the first time in over sixty years, this idyllic Laguna Beach cottage exemplifies the quintessential beach cottage lifestyle. Mere feet from the sandy beach of iconic Fishermans Cove, with expansive ocean and coastline views, this three bedroom, two bath home was originally constructed in the '20s as a holiday place to enjoy local fishing. The exterior is clad in redwood siding and features a large brick patio with sit down white water ocean views as well as a private side yard which can be accessed from the main living area and one of two ground floor bedrooms. Inside, the main living area features a classic exposed beam ceiling and warmly greets occupants with a wood burning fireplace framed by floor to ceiling wood paneling and a mantle which was sourced from Edgar Allen Poes childhood home in Richmond Virginia (c.1810) which earns this home its moniker: "Raven House. Original Knotty Pine "Laguna Paneling and Douglas Fir flooring are carried throughout the home which has a completely updated electrical system, newer roof and plumbing replaced with copper supply and ABS lines, new central heater and 10 of fiberglass batting insulation in the attic.
